Daily Face

Daily Face

Let's begin, shall we?
Multiple splashes of hotness
Triggers a jolted wakefulness.
Red and new, raw and true.
We can do this.
It's just another day.
How hard can this one be?
At what hour shall defeat toll?
Everything starts with controlled smiles
And ends in mistrust and glimmering hate.
Coffee should work this foul mood.
Chocolate must keep us in line.
Beer will thankfully soothe us after the matter.
Shoot.
Mineaswell have a super cheesy pizza, too.
I don't want to go out there.
Alas, money is required for what we deem survival.
I should run.
But how far can I go?
How long can I last?
Never far enough or long at all.
I already dread the next face I carve.
